About the Lab
Professor Hoi-soo Yoon's research lab specializes in pediatric hematology and oncology, with a strong focus on rare and complex hematologic disorders such as hemophagocytic lymphohistiocytosis (HLH), congenital and acquired coagulopathies, and pediatric hematopoietic stem cell transplantation (HSCT). The lab conducts nationwide retrospective studies to understand the clinical, genetic, and virologic factors influencing disease outcomes in children, particularly in the context of viral infections (e.g., EBV, CMV) and immune dysregulation. The research also extends to vascular tumors like infantile hemangioendothelioma, exploring multimodal treatment strategies in critically ill infants. The lab emphasizes translational research, integrating clinical data with molecular insights to improve diagnosis, risk stratification, and therapeutic outcomes in pediatric blood disorders.

BACKGROUND: We analyzed a nationwide registry of pediatric patients with hemophagocytic lymphohistiocytosis (HLH) in Korea to assess the clinical and genetic features and treatment outcomes in pediatric HLH. METHODS: The Korea Histiocytosis Working Party retrospectively analyzed data on 251 pediatric patients diagnosed with HLH between 1996 and 2011. CMV infection is one of the major causes of morbidity and mortality after HSCT. The aim of this single center retrospective study was to analyze risk factors for CMV infection in pediatric patients who underwent HSCT. We retrospectively reviewed the medical records of 117 pediatric patients who underwent allogeneic HSCT at Asan Medical Center between December 2000 and January 2007. Chemoimmunotherapy-based treatments have improved the survival of patients with HLH, but outcomes of the patients are still unsatisfactory. We report here the outcome of Korean children with HLH who underwent HSCT, which was analyzed from the data of a nation-wide HLH registry. Retrospective nation-wide data recruitment for the pediatric HLH patients diagnosed between 1996 and 2008 was carried out by the Histiocytosis Working Party of the Korean Society of Hematology. Infantile hemangioendothelioma (IHE) is a rare benign vascular tumor with potentially life-threatening complications. Various therapeutic options have been recommended according to the site, extent, and behavior of the IHE. Because of the slow and unpredictable response to treatment with using a single drug in critically ill patients, there is a tendency to administer drugs in combination to treat this disease. The objective of this study is to analyze the major causes of abnormal findings seen in the preoperative coagulation tests of asymptomatic pediatric patients and to discuss the usefulness of coagulation tests prior to minor surgery. Among patients who received minor surgery in Kyung Hee University Medical Center from March 2008 to April 2015, a total of 7114 pediatric patients (ages 1-18) were included in our study. This is the first nationwide population-based study of congenital bleeding disorders in Korea. This study provides data that will enable more accurate estimations of patients with vWD. This information will help advance the comprehensive care of congenital bleeding disorders. We need to continue to obtain more detailed information on patients to improve the management of these diseases.
B iotherapy, often called biological therapy or immunotherapy, aims at supporting and helping in the treatment of human disease without chemical drugs and invasive therapies, by restoring the natural immune system. It is also used to reduce certain side effects that may be caused by some treatments against cancer, autoimmune diseases, or other diseases. I ron deficiency anemia (IDA) frequently occurs in infants and adolescents. IDA is the result of an interplay between increased host requirements, limited external supply, and increased blood loss. In outpatient clinics, we often see children with iron deficiency anemia. Most cases in children are caused by incomplete nutrient supplements and growth spurts. Bruising and bleeding are common events in children. The pediatrician must be able to determine whether a child's symptoms are normal or perhaps indicative of hemorrhagic disorders. A thorough medical history and physical examination should enable the pediatricians to identify those patients warranting further evaluation.
